There is so much to do and keep busy. The Cango Caves - must see. The Cango Ostrich farm, an amazing experience. Then there was the Wild Life Ranch - have to go! Buffelsdrift, amazingly beautiful. The Rust& Vrede waterfalls - please take cash! The Spur with their friendly staff and the newly opened Hennies! Wish we had a few more days. Uniondale was the centre point of our journey distance wise - so convenient . Also we had not been there before so it made an interesting stop over. Scenery was stunning and the road excellent. Hotel built in 1832 (I understand). Uniondale is about 14 kms off main road and entry and exit are through two mountain passes which were most attractive.Guest review byChristopherSouth Africa - 8.0

Route 62 is a great drive and Barrydale is a convenient distance from Cape Town for a stop, The village is small but has interesting places to visit. Arrive in time to look round and leave the next by lunchtime the next day - that's all the time you need but it's worth taking time to stop and look round. We found it a friendly place and were not pestered by beggars.Guest review byAnonymous
